Disney, MySpace give fans a 'Piratized' avatar
 
Indiantelevision.com Team
(18 May 2007 2:00 pm)
 

MUMBAI: For the upcoming Disney feature film Pirates of the Caribbean: At World's End, Buena Vista Pictures' online marketing department has unveiled a new way to talk to Pirate fans with a special online interactive feature called the "Piratizer."

The official MySpace profile page for the movie http://myspace.com/AtWorldsEnd allows users to send in a single photo of themselves and get back an animated 3-D version along with accessories including hats, scars, tattoos, jewelry. Moreover, fans sporting the Pirate avatar are even able to talk like a pirate.

According to an official release, over 80,000 fans have been 'Piratized' in less than a week.

"The Piratizer allows Pirates of the Caribbean fans all over the world to interact with our brand in a unique and personal way, allowing them to take ownership of the franchise and share it with their family and friends," said Buena Vista Pictures Marketing president Jim Gallagher.
